LCCC student caught with gun on campus
Edward Lewis elewis@timesleader.com
NANTICOKE - A student at Luzerne County Community College was charged with possessing a gun on campus Tuesday morning.
click image to enlarge
Christian Zaccagni Sr., 47, leaves an arraignment after being charged with possessing a loaded firearm on the campus of Luzerne County Community College on Tuesday.
Christian Zaccagni Sr. said he forgot the firearm, which he said weighs three ounces, was in his coat. Zaccagni said the firearm was discovered during anatomy class. He claimed to be a nursing student at the college.
Zaccagni, 47, of Dana Street, Wilkes-Barre, was arraigned by District Judge Donald Whittaker on charges of firearms not to be carried without a license and possession of a firearm on school property. He was jailed at Luzerne County Prison for lack of $10,000 bail.

W-B man charged after bringing loaded gun to LCCC
BY BOB KALINOWSKI, STAFF WRITER
Published: March 1, 2011
<snip>Security officers found the gun after reporting to a classroom for the report of a man "displaying erratic behavior." During a pat-down search, officers felt the gun, a .380 caliber automatic handgun.
"I accidentally walked in school with it. I made a bad mistake and it's going to cost me," he told reporters at his arraignment in front of Magisterial District Judge Donald Whittaker.
